Frequently Asked Questions About Funeral Homes in Dunnellon

Common questions about funeral services and funeral homes in Dunnellon, Florida.

Q1.What are the typical costs for a traditional funeral service at a funeral home in Dunnellon, Florida?

In Dunnellon, Florida, the average cost for a traditional funeral service, including viewing, ceremony, and burial, ranges from $7,000 to $12,000, depending on the funeral home and specific selections. This typically includes basic services, embalming, casket, and use of facilities. Prices can vary based on additional options like flowers, obituaries, or transportation, so it's advisable to request a detailed price list from local providers like Roberts Funeral Homes or other Dunnellon establishments.

Q2.Are there any specific Florida state regulations or local Dunnellon requirements for burial or cremation?

Yes, Florida state law requires a 48-hour waiting period before cremation can occur, and a death certificate must be filed with the local health department. In Dunnellon, which is in Marion County, burials must comply with county zoning laws, and permits are required for interment in local cemeteries like Dunnellon Cemetery. It's important to work with a licensed funeral director in Florida to ensure all legal requirements are met.

Q3.What funeral service options are available for veterans and their families in Dunnellon, FL?

Funeral homes in Dunnellon, such as Roberts Funeral Homes, often provide specialized services for veterans, including assistance with obtaining military honors, burial flags, and VA benefits. Veterans may be eligible for burial at Florida National Cemetery in Bushnell, which is about 30 minutes from Dunnellon, with arrangements coordinated through the funeral home. Local organizations like the American Legion Post 58 in Dunnellon can also offer support for veteran memorial services.

Q4.How can I pre-plan a funeral in Dunnellon, and what are the benefits of doing so in Florida?

Pre-planning a funeral in Dunnellon involves meeting with a local funeral home to discuss your wishes and lock in current prices, which can protect against future cost increases. In Florida, pre-paid funeral plans are regulated by the state to ensure funds are safeguarded, often through trusts or insurance. This process reduces the emotional and financial burden on family members and ensures your preferences are honored at Dunnellon-area funeral homes.
